Methadone Treatment Near Cadillac, Michigan

Cadillac sits a long way from the nearest opioid treatment program. The closest verified OTP is 54.8 miles away in Mt Pleasant. At that distance, methadone is rarely the practical first choice. Office-based buprenorphine, prescribed by any DEA-registered clinician, is usually the more realistic path.

Overdose context for Wexford County

Wexford County reported a model-based drug poisoning death rate of 35.8 per 100,000 residents in 2021 (95% CI 30 to 42.7). That sits 25.8% above the national county mean of 28.5 per 100,000.

201923.9
202031
202135.8

Three-year change (23.9 to 35.8): +11.8 per 100,000.

County-level estimates are reported at the county level, not the city level. Source: NCHS Drug Poisoning Mortality by County (CDC dataset rpvx-m2md), 2019 to 2021 model-based estimates. NCHS urban/rural classification: Micropolitan.

Closest methadone clinic to Cadillac

Nearest verified opioid treatment program in Michigan: Michigan Therapeutic PC in Mt Pleasant, about 54.8 miles (88.2 km) from Cadillac by straight-line distance. Driving time will run longer.
